Check with … WebRequirements for license exempt providers. License exempt means you are not required to be licensed by the Office of Child Care (OCC) in order to provide child care.. ODHS requires license exempt providers to complete a background check , take training, pass a site visit , and test drinking water for lead.There are some exceptions if a relative is …

Web16. jun 2024. · A Dependent Care FSA allows you to set aside tax-free dollars from your paycheck to pay for eligible child or adult dependent care expenses. In addition to care options such as day camps and after-school care, in-home care through a babysitter, nanny, or au pair would be eligible.
